    Hudson Valley Community College

    Hudson Valley Community College (HVCC) delivers its Aviation Maintenance Technician Program through the Aeronautical Technical Institute (ATI), a specialized training hub located directly at Albany International Airport (ALB). That airport-based setting is one of the program’s biggest strengths: ATI is designed around advanced aviation labs, testing equipment, and a fully operational maintenance hangar with immediate airfield access. For students, that means training happens in a context that closely resembles the workplaces where A&P technicians actually build their careers.

    HVCC’s ATI Aviation Maintenance Technician Program is framed as a 12-month pathway with extensive hands-on instruction. The school emphasizes small class sizes and personal attention from instructors important in a skill trade where feedback and repetition are what turn I watched it once into I can do it safely and correctly. Coursework focuses on the design, construction, maintenance, and repair of major aircraft systems and components, including hydraulics and pneumatics devices, propulsion systems, propellers, aircraft painting, component overhaul, basic electronics, environmental systems, sheet metal, composite structures, and both fixed-wing and rotor-wing aircraft topics. Program objectives include building knowledge of FAA regulations and procedures and developing safe work habits and skills two themes that employers consistently care about in maintenance hiring.

    ATI also explains the certification pathway in practical terms. FAA certification requires passing written, oral, and practical exams, and the school notes that the rigor of those exams is exactly why AMT/A&P credentials are highly regarded. By structuring training around exam readiness and hands-on competence, ATI aims to help students not only meet the testing bar, but also demonstrate workplace readiness when they begin applying to airlines, repair stations, manufacturers, corporate flight departments, and general aviation organizations.

    From a logistics standpoint, ATI publishes clear contact details and is explicit about its airport location: 6 Jetway Drive, Albany, NY 12211. HVCC also publishes upcoming class timing and, through workforce development schedules, lists a daytime training cadence (8:00 a.m. to 4:00 p.m.) and a published program cost for at least some cohorts. That transparency helps students plan around work, childcare, and relocation.

    Minneapolis College

    Minneapolis College’s Aircraft Maintenance Technician program is built for students who want a direct, hands-on route to earning FAA Airframe and Powerplant (A&P) eligibility while training in a real airline maintenance environment. The program is delivered off campus inside a Delta Air Lines maintenance facility at Minneapolis-St. Paul International Airport (Delta Air Lines, Building C, 7500 Airline Drive, Minneapolis, MN 55450). That location matters: instead of learning aircraft maintenance only in a traditional campus lab, students train in proximity to large-scale commercial maintenance operations and the people who do it every day.

    Program structure is cohort-based and intentionally paced. Minneapolis College accepts a new cohort once per year in the fall semester, and students complete the curriculum over six continuous semesters (fall, spring, and summer). Courses are scheduled Monday through Thursday, which helps many students maintain part-time work or family responsibilities while still completing a rigorous technical program. The program is offered as an Associate of Applied Science (A.A.S.) degree track, and the college also lists a diploma option; both are designed around the FAA-required subject areas and hours needed to prepare for A&P testing.

    In terms of what you learn, the program combines classroom instruction with extensive lab practice. Students develop core maintenance competencies such as interpreting technical manuals and drawings, applying Federal Aviation Regulations, troubleshooting aircraft systems, and performing service, repair, and inspection tasks to an FAA standard. Training includes aircraft structures and sheet metal, systems and components, and engine-related learning that supports the powerplant side of A&P outcomes. Because aviation maintenance is a team environment, the program also emphasizes communication, decision-making, and safe work habits, which are essential in a professional shop.

    A major differentiator is the program’s partnership history and industry integration. Minneapolis College notes a public-private partnership with Delta Air Lines/Endeavor Air that relocated the program into Delta’s facilities, and the program routinely incorporates learning opportunities made possible by that relationship, including guest speakers and commercial-aviation-specific training. If you’re targeting airline maintenance as a career destination, exposure to commercial operations and expectations can be a meaningful advantage.

    Students should plan for tuition and typical aviation program extras (books, tools, and FAA exam fees), and should contact the program or admissions for the most current total cost, required tools list, and annual cohort start dates.     U.S. Aviation Academy – San Marcos

    US Aviation Academy’s San Marcos location offers an accelerated path to FAA Airframe & Powerplant (A&P) mechanic certification through its FAA Part 147 program based at San Marcos Regional Airport.
    The program is built for students who want an immersive, hands-on training experience that mirrors the work environment of an aircraft maintenance shop. Training is focused on the practical skills employers expect from entry-level technicians: inspecting aircraft structures and systems, troubleshooting mechanical issues, performing repairs in accordance with FAA standards, and documenting maintenance properly.

    A standout feature of the San Marcos offering is that it is structured as an accelerated option, with a daytime track designed to be completed in about eight months, plus an evening option for students who need a longer, after-hours schedule. That flexibility can be especially helpful for career-changers who are balancing work and family responsibilities while working toward an A&P certificate. Because the campus is located on an active airport, students are learning in an environment where aviation is happening all around them, which can reinforce the real-world feel of the training.

    The curriculum is intended to cover both airframe and powerplant subject areas so graduates can apply and test for the full A&P mechanic certificate. In practice, that means exposure to airframe structures and sheet metal work, basic electricity, aircraft drawings and regulations, landing gear and hydraulic systems, fuel systems, environmental systems, engine theory, reciprocating and turbine topics, and the inspection mindset that’s central to safe maintenance. Students should expect a blend of classroom instruction, lab work, and structured hands-on tasks that help them build confidence with tools, procedures, and maintenance workflows.
